HC asks DSIIDC to pay Rs 10L compensation to kin of victim manual scavengers

The Delhi High Court has directed government company DSIIDC to pay Rs 10 lakh compensation each to the families of two manual scavengers who died while cleaning a sewer in Bawana Industrial Area here. The court said Delhi State Industrial and Infrastructure Development Corporation Ltd (DSIIDC), which is responsible for developing and providing industrial infrastructure facilities to the entrepreneurs here, should have taken necessary steps to ensure that sewers are not opened for cleaning purposes by anyone. HC directs EO wing to take steps in identifying properties owned by dairy firm executives

The Madras High Court has directed the Economic Offences (EO) Wing of the Central Crime Branch to take steps for identifying immovable properties in the name of executives of HBN Dairies and Allied Limited, which is alleged to have cheated around 20 lakh depositors of Rs 1,137 crore. Justice M S Ramesh passed the order on a criminal original petition filed by one Immanuel, seeking an investigation into the matter in a reasonable time frame as fixed by the court. Parents of boy killed in accident get Rs 5 lakh compensation

The Motor Accident Claims Tribunal (MACT) here has awarded a compensation of Rs 5 lakh to the parents of a class 3 student who was mowed down by a speeding truck in 2016. MACT member and district judge K D Vadane ordered the truck owner and the vehicle’s insurer to jointly and severally make the payment to the boy’s parents along with an interest at 8 per cent per annum from the date of filing of the claim. Eminent jurist in panel for selecting Lokpal to be appointed soon: Centre to SC

The Centre today told the Supreme Court that the selection committee for appointing a Lokpal met on March 1 and decided to first fill up the vacancy of an eminent jurist in the panel. Attorney General K K Venugopal told a bench comprising Justices Ranjan Gogoi and R Banumathi that the vacancy of an eminent jurist in the committee, which also includes the prime minister, would be done at the earliest.
